What is Southwest Airlines Manage My Booking?
Southwest Airlines Manage My Booking is an online self-service feature that allows passengers to access and modify their flight reservations after purchasing a ticket.
This tool is available through the official Southwest website and mobile app. It helps travelers manage almost every part of their booking from one dashboard.
With this feature, passengers can:
- change travel dates
- reschedule flight times
- cancel reservations
- apply travel credits
- check flight status
- update passenger details
- add baggage
- select or update seats (for eligible fare types and routes)
- request same-day flight changes
- split group reservations in certain cases
The main purpose of Southwest Airlines Manage My Booking is convenience. Instead of calling customer service, most travelers can handle changes within minutes online.
Southwest is known for flexible booking options. One of the biggest advantages is that most fare types allow flight changes, although fare differences may apply.
This makes the manage booking system especially useful for travelers whose plans change frequently.

Important Rules, Fees, or Policy Details
Understanding the policy behind Southwest Airlines Manage My Booking is important before making changes.
1. Flight Change Policy
Southwest generally allows flight changes without a separate airline change fee.
However:
- fare difference may apply
- new flight price may be higher
- taxes may change
This is one of the biggest benefits for travelers.
2. Cancellation Policy
Most tickets can be canceled online.
Important points:
- cancel at least 10 minutes before departure
- travel funds may be forfeited after that
- refundable fares return money to original payment method
- non-refundable fares become travel credit
3. Same-Day Change
Southwest also allows same-day flight changes on eligible tickets.
Rules include:
- must request before original departure
- subject to seat availability
- some fare types may be excluded
4. Group Booking Split
Southwest allows splitting a booking while changing flights.
This is helpful when only one traveler wants to change plans.
5. Travel Credits
Canceled bookings may become flight credit.
These credits usually have an expiration timeline depending on fare type.
